Interesting cRIO delays

So while testing on bag&tag day I noticed some odd behavior coming from our robot.

First I will explain our setup. We have 2 separate axle shafts connected to encoders which I feed into 4 DMA channels which then return the rates of those shafts. I used modified versions of the example code for DMA encoders to accomplish this. I have these rates fed into PID functions to control the rate of the motors. This code is in its own loop in periodic tasks and is running as a 10ms loop. (Problem?)

I noticed that immediately after deploying the code, the delay between spinning the wheel and the encoder response was in-observable. However, as the testing continued the delay began to grow until it was at about a second after a few minutes of testing. When I stopped and redeployed the code, I would get temporary relif, but after a few minutes, the delay returned. I also noted that as the evening progressed the delay became larger and larger.

Additionally, at some point in the evening several motors including some on the drivetrain and shooter wheels began to twitch (turn on momentarily (<.5sec) and then stop.

Some of our mentors believe that the problem might be the ribbon cable that we were using to connect the DIO modules to the DS...

Does anyone have any explanations/workarounds for these problems.
